A recollection of a serial “embarrass-ee”.
Have you ever had to stand up and do a presentation and have things go awry, say something you shouldn’t have or fall over in front of a large group of people? We all have embarrassing moments; some can merely make us slightly self conscious whereas others can be mortifying.
Personally I can reel off a whole list of embarrassing moments, from public humiliation to clumsy mishaps! A particular highlight is being hit in the head with a conker and promptly falling on the floor – with a whole field of people to watch and another being tripping over a hole in the ground and dropping all of my bags everywhere. Falling over and other minor accidents can, for many people, perhaps the friends of said person, be hilarious and most people will be able to laugh off these types of calamities and they can then be forgotten.
However it tends to be the ‘public humiliation’ that sticks in your mind and have more of a lasting effect. Schools a minefield of embarrassing events to be dodged! From teachers picking on you to simply talking to a guy you like, you always have to be looking out for the next potentially awkward event! In my five years of high school, I certainly racked up many!
As a young, awkward and painfully shy thirteen year old I can remember my teachers constantly picking on me as I would never contribute during lessons. But this would instantly make me blush a bright red and once I could feel my cheeks getting hot and became aware of it, this would make me even more embarrassed and thus become even redder and this was all before I had even asked the question! I remember one teacher who took particular joy in ‘nuking me’ as he so delightfully put it.
These days the blushing has become less frequent but the embarrassing moments haven’t and like most people if there is some sort of social catastrophe I dwell on it for hours, maybe days, even though everyone else will have forgotten that it even happened. Replaying the event is a particularly painful way to remember what an idiot or clumsy buffoon you were!
